Abstract
In this paper, we study the existence of the following optimal solution for the system of differential inclusion
y′ ∈ Φ(t,y(t)) a.e. t ∈ I = [t0,b] and y(t0) = u2,
y′ ∈ Ψ(t,y(t)) a.e. t ∈ I = [t0,b] and y(t0) = u1.
in a Hilbert space, where Φ and Ψ are multivalued maps. Our existence result is obtained via selection technique and the best proximity point methods reducing the problem to a differential inclusion.
